Trusts

Our wills and estates lawyers have experience with the preparation and administration of multiple types of trusts. Depending on your unique needs, we can help you identify and create a trust that best suits your circumstances. Our legal team is able to assist with:

  • Testamentary Trusts: Including cottage trusts, principal residence trusts, spousal trusts, and more.
  • Inter Vivos Trusts: Also referred to as family trusts, these may be established during your lifetime with the help of an estate lawyer.
  • Disability Trusts: We can help you ensure financial security for any beneficiaries you have with special needs.

Our wills and estates team works collaboratively with our firm’s corporate department. This means we also regularly assist with trust issues embedded within corporate or business reorganization matters.

Estate Administration & Probate Matters

The administration of a loved one’s affairs after their death can be a complex process. It is often the case that individuals named as executors or trustees in a will have no prior experience in estate administration. At SimpsonWigle LAW LLP, we assist executors and estate trustees with their legal and financial obligations. 

We can help individuals navigate:

  • Real estate transactions from an estate perspective
  • Estate accounting
  • Passing of accounts
  • Real estate transfers
  • Distribution of assets to beneficiaries
  • Guardianship applications
  • Estate probate applications
  • Applications for Certificate of Appointment of Estate Trustee 
  • Handling testate and intestate matters
  • And more
